GHSA-87fh-rc96-6fr6: Unauthenticated Spree Commerce users can access all guest addresses
A critical IDOR vulnerability exists in Spree Commerce’s guest checkout flow that allows any guest user to bind arbitrary guest addresses to their order by manipulating address ID parameters. This enables unauthorized access to other guests’ personally identifiable information (PII) including names, addresses and phone numbers. The vulnerability bypasses existing ownership validation checks and affects all guest checkout transactions.
